FAQs
Q1: What makes a jigsaw puzzle hard?
Piece count, color uniformity, and tricky designs like double-sided or transparent puzzles increase difficulty.
Q2: What’s the largest jigsaw puzzle ever made?
Some commercial puzzles exceed 50,000 pieces, setting Guinness records.
Q3: Are digital puzzles as beneficial as physical ones?
Yes, both improve memory, focus, and relaxation, though physical puzzles offer tactile joy.
Q4: Can puzzles be considered art?
Absolutely! Many collectors frame puzzles or invest in handcrafted wooden puzzles as art.
